CIDE DICTIONARY

persistencyn. [See Persistent.].
  •  The quality or state of being persistent; staying or continuing quality; hence, in an unfavorable sense, doggedness; obstinacy.  [1913 Webster]
  •  The continuance of an effect after the cause which first gave rise to it is removed  [1913 Webster]
